📝 Abstract
Understanding social interactions from non-verbal visual data is important for behavior analysis and activity monitoring. We propose an interpretable computational model of social engagement inspired by psychological theories of mutual visual attention. Rather than learning interaction patterns end-to-end, our framework explicitly models dyadic visual attention and aggregates these cues into interpretable measures of individual and group engagement. The resulting modular framework combines state-of-the-art head orientation estimation with lightweight geometric reasoning, producing explanations that remain accessible to non-technical users. We evaluate the proposed approach on a variety of data through quantitative experiments and demonstrate its practical usefulness with qualitative visualizations designed to support teachers, caregivers, and social workers in understanding group interaction dynamics.
